Kasha Varniskes from The Complete Guide to Traditional Jewish Cooking by Marlena Spieler
This combination of buckwheat groats, mushrooms and bow-shaped pasta is a classic a Shkenazic dish from Poland, Ukraine and Russia. It may be an acquired taste,
Ingredients
- salt and ground black pepper
- 200 g/7 oz pasta bows
- 300 g/11 oz/1½ cups whole coarse, medium or fine buckwheat
- 250 g/9 oz mushrooms, sliced
- 3–4 onions, thinly sliced
- 45 ml/3 tbsp rendered chicken fat (for a meat meal), vegetable oil (for a pareve meal) or 40 g/1½ oz/3 tbsp butter (for a dairy meal)
- 500 ml/17 fl oz/2¼ cups boiling vegetable stock or water
- 25 g/1 oz dried well-flavoured mushrooms, such as ceps
